The College of Applied Arts at Alnoor University organized educational workshops in collaboration with Valery Company.

The College of Applied Arts The College of Applied Arts at Alnoor University, through the Department of Interior Design, held three interactive workshops in the field of ceramics and porcelain for first-year students of the Interior Design Department, in cooperation with Valeri Company. The workshops were presented by the company's director and the head of its ceramics and porcelain division, along with Assistant Lecturer Aws Khalid Al-Dabbagh, who teaches the subject of 3D Engineering Drawing in the department. They provided a detailed presentation on the use of these materials in bathrooms, floors, and walls, explaining the different types, thickness grades of each type, and how they are installed. They also discussed how interior designers can provide solutions while considering the differences between the two materials in terms of their manufacturing composition.
 During these workshops, students showed lively engagement by asking questions and participating in vibrant scientific discussions between the company team and the department staff. The workshop represented a practical application of the theoretical study for students in the Interior Design Department. The sessions were supervised by Dr. Nazar Abdullateef Ahmed Dean of the College of Applied Arts.
